María Falcón is a Puerto Rican television reporter, show host and television producer.[1] She worked for many years at channel 6 and at Channel 7 on Puerto Rico's television and as of 2016, on a television show named GeoAmbiente, which is transmitted on a television channel named Sistema TV.[2]

During a very long time, Falcón, along with Miss Universe 1985 Deborah Carthy-Deu and legendary actor and comedian Yoyo Boing, hosted a television show named Desde Mi Pueblo on WIPR-TV.[3]

During 2013, she was personally nominated by Puerto Rican governor Alejandro García Padilla to become channel 6's president.[4]

During 2021, Falcón was given a special award by WIPR-TV for her continuing work on Puerto Rican television.[5]

Personal

[edit]

Falcón is a native of Bayamón, Puerto Rico. She and her husband Steve Dalmau, a construction industry executive, live at Barrio Cubuy in Canóvanas, Puerto Rico.[1]
